Shenliu Town is the county seat of Anxiang County, located in Hunan Province, China. The town covers an area of 68.32 km2 (26.38 sq mi) and serves as a primary administrative center for the region.
The town was established in September 2008 through the amalgamation of Chengguan Town and Anyou Township. It derives its name from the famous Shenliu Academy, a historical site built during the Qing dynasty situated in the northern part of the town. As of recent data, the town has a population of 125,192 and oversees nine communities and 13 villages.
